#!/usr/bin/env python3
|
|
"""
|
|
train_grpo_v2.py — GRPO training on 50K real audit findings.
|
|
|
|
V2 improvements over V1:
|
|
- 155x more data (50,902 vs 327)
|
|
- 4 reward functions with ground-truth severity/category matching
|
|
- Reference-based semantic similarity reward
|
|
- Better exploration via higher num_generations
|
|
"""

# ─── Reward Function 1: Structure & Format (weight: 0.25) ────────────────────
|
|
|
|
def format_reward(prompts, completions, completion_ids=None, **kwargs):
|
|
"""Reward for producing structured FINDING blocks and proper formatting."""
|
|
rewards = []
|
|
for completion in completions:
|
|
text = completion[0]["content"] if isinstance(completion, list) else str(completion)
|
|
reward = 0.0
|
|
|
|
# FINDING block present
|
|
if re.search(r'FINDING\s*\|', text):
|
|
reward += 0.3
|
|
# Required fields
|
|
fields = ['contract:', 'function:', 'bug_class:', 'confidence:']
|
|
field_count = sum(1 for f in fields if f in text)
|
|
reward += 0.05 * field_count # up to 0.2 more
|
|
|
|
# Has code block
|
|
if re.search(r'```solidity', text):
|
|
reward += 0.15
|
|
|
|
# Has structured sections
|
|
section_keywords = ['description', 'impact', 'proof', 'fix', 'recommendation', 'mitigation']
|
|
section_count = sum(1 for kw in section_keywords if re.search(rf'(?i)(###?\s*{kw}|{kw}:)', text))
|
|
reward += 0.05 * min(section_count, 3) # up to 0.15
|
|
|
|
# Penalize very short or very long
|
|
if len(text) < 50:
|
|
reward -= 0.3
|
|
elif len(text) > 4000:
|
|
reward -= 0.1
|
|
|
|
rewards.append(max(-1.0, min(1.0, reward)))
|
|
return rewards
|
|
|
|
|
|
# ─── Reward Function 2: Severity Match (weight: 0.25) ────────────────────────
|
|
|
|
def severity_reward(prompts, completions, completion_ids=None, severity=None, **kwargs):
|
|
"""Reward for correctly identifying the severity level."""
|
|
rewards = []
|
|
|
|
if severity is None:
|
|
return [0.0] * len(completions)
|
|
|
|
# Handle batch: severity may be a list
|
|
if isinstance(severity, list):
|
|
sev_list = severity
|
|
else:
|
|
sev_list = [severity] * len(completions)
|
|
|
|
for i, completion in enumerate(completions):
|
|
text = completion[0]["content"] if isinstance(completion, list) else str(completion)
|
|
text_lower = text.lower()
|
|
|
|
gt_sev = sev_list[i] if i < len(sev_list) else "unknown"
|
|
if gt_sev == "unknown":
|
|
rewards.append(0.0)
|
|
continue
|
|
|
|
# Extract predicted severity
|
|
pred_sev = None
|
|
sev_match = re.search(r'(?i)(critical|high|medium|low|informational|gas)', text_lower)
|
|
if sev_match:
|
|
pred_sev = sev_match.group(1).lower()
|
|
|
|
if pred_sev is None:
|
|
rewards.append(-0.3)
|
|
elif pred_sev == gt_sev:
|
|
rewards.append(1.0) # Exact match
|
|
elif abs(_sev_rank(pred_sev) - _sev_rank(gt_sev)) == 1:
|
|
rewards.append(0.3) # Off by one level
|
|
else:
|
|
rewards.append(-0.5) # Way off
|
|
|
|
return rewards
|
|
|
|
|
|
def _sev_rank(sev):
|
|
ranks = {"critical": 5, "high": 4, "medium": 3, "low": 2, "informational": 1, "gas": 0}
|
|
return ranks.get(sev, -1)
|
|
|
|
|
|
# ─── Reward Function 3: Vulnerability Category (weight: 0.25) ────────────────
|
|
|
|
CATEGORY_KEYWORDS = {
|
|
"reentrancy": ["reentrancy", "reentrant", "re-enter", "callback"],
|
|
"access-control": ["access control", "unauthorized", "permission", "onlyowner", "role", "privilege"],
|
|
"oracle": ["oracle", "price feed", "chainlink", "twap", "price manipulation"],
|
|
"flash-loan": ["flash loan", "flashloan"],
|
|
"overflow": ["overflow", "underflow", "arithmetic"],
|
|
"front-running": ["front-run", "frontrun", "sandwich", "mev"],
|
|
"dos": ["denial of service", "dos", "gas limit", "unbounded", "out of gas"],
|
|
"token": ["erc20", "erc721", "token", "fee-on-transfer", "rebasing"],
|
|
"storage": ["storage collision", "delegatecall", "proxy", "slot"],
|
|
"cross-chain": ["bridge", "cross-chain", "relay", "message passing"],
|
|
"liquidation": ["liquidation", "collateral", "health factor"],
|
|
"signature": ["signature", "ecrecover", "replay", "nonce", "eip712"],
|
|
"initialization": ["initialize", "constructor", "uninitialized"],
|
|
"rounding": ["rounding", "precision", "truncation", "decimal"],
|
|
"logic": ["logic error", "incorrect calculation", "business logic"],
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
def category_reward(prompts, completions, completion_ids=None, category=None, **kwargs):
|
|
"""Reward for identifying the correct vulnerability category."""
|
|
rewards = []
|
|
|
|
if category is None:
|
|
return [0.0] * len(completions)
|
|
|
|
if isinstance(category, list):
|
|
cat_list = category
|
|
else:
|
|
cat_list = [category] * len(completions)
|
|
|
|
for i, completion in enumerate(completions):
|
|
text = completion[0]["content"] if isinstance(completion, list) else str(completion)
|
|
text_lower = text.lower()
|
|
|
|
gt_cat = cat_list[i] if i < len(cat_list) else "other"
|
|
if gt_cat == "other" or gt_cat == "unknown":
|
|
# Can't evaluate — neutral reward
|
|
rewards.append(0.0)
|
|
continue
|
|
|
|
# Check if the model mentions keywords from the ground truth category
|
|
gt_keywords = CATEGORY_KEYWORDS.get(gt_cat, [])
|
|
if not gt_keywords:
|
|
rewards.append(0.0)
|
|
continue
|
|
|
|
hits = sum(1 for kw in gt_keywords if kw in text_lower)
|
|
if hits >= 2:
|
|
rewards.append(1.0)
|
|
elif hits == 1:
|
|
rewards.append(0.5)
|
|
else:
|
|
# Check if it mentions ANY vulnerability category (at least trying)
|
|
any_hit = any(kw in text_lower for kws in CATEGORY_KEYWORDS.values() for kw in kws)
|
|
rewards.append(-0.2 if any_hit else -0.5)
|
|
|
|
return rewards

# ─── Reward Function 4: Content Quality (weight: 0.25) ───────────────────────
|
|
|
|
def quality_reward(prompts, completions, completion_ids=None, **kwargs):
|
|
"""Reward for overall response quality: technical depth, actionability."""
|
|
rewards = []
|
|
for completion in completions:
|
|
text = completion[0]["content"] if isinstance(completion, list) else str(completion)
|
|
reward = 0.0
|
|
|
|
# Technical indicators
|
|
technical_terms = [
|
|
'msg.sender', 'tx.origin', 'delegatecall', 'selfdestruct',
|
|
'transfer', 'call.value', 'abi.encode', 'keccak256',
|
|
'require(', 'assert(', 'revert', 'mapping', 'storage',
|
|
'memory', 'calldata', 'modifier', 'interface', 'pragma',
|
|
'assembly', 'unchecked', 'payable', 'receive()', 'fallback()',
|
|
]
|
|
tech_count = sum(1 for t in technical_terms if t in text)
|
|
reward += min(0.3, 0.03 * tech_count)
|
|
|
|
# Explanation quality (has reasoning)
|
|
reasoning_indicators = [
|
|
'because', 'therefore', 'this means', 'as a result',
|
|
'the attacker can', 'this allows', 'leading to',
|
|
'step 1', 'step 2', 'first,', 'then,', 'finally,',
|
|
]
|
|
reasoning_count = sum(1 for r in reasoning_indicators if r.lower() in text.lower())
|
|
reward += min(0.3, 0.06 * reasoning_count)
|
|
|
|
# Actionable fix provided
|
|
fix_indicators = ['fix:', 'recommendation:', 'mitigation:', 'should', 'consider', 'instead']
|
|
fix_count = sum(1 for f in fix_indicators if f.lower() in text.lower())
|
|
reward += min(0.2, 0.05 * fix_count)
|
|
|
|
# Code reference specificity
|
|
if re.search(r'line\s+\d+|L\d+|#L\d+', text):
|
|
reward += 0.1
|
|
if re.search(r'function\s+\w+\s*\(', text):
|
|
reward += 0.1
|
|
|
|
# Penalize generic/unhelpful responses
|
|
generic_phrases = ['i cannot', 'i don\'t', 'no vulnerabilities found', 'the code looks safe']
|
|
if any(p in text.lower() for p in generic_phrases):
|
|
reward -= 0.5
|
|
|
|
rewards.append(max(-1.0, min(1.0, reward)))
|
|
return rewards

# GRPO Config — tuned for 0.5B on T4 (16GB VRAM)
|
|
config = GRPOConfig(
|
|
output_dir=OUTPUT_DIR,
|
|
num_train_epochs=1, # 1 epoch over 15K samples = plenty
|
|
per_device_train_batch_size=2,
|
|
gradient_accumulation_steps=4, # effective batch = 8
|
|
num_generations=2,
|
|
max_completion_length=768, # more room for detailed findings
|
|
learning_rate=1e-6, # slightly higher lr for more data
|
|
beta=0.04, # small KL penalty to prevent mode collapse with large dataset
|
|
scale_rewards=True,
|
|
reward_weights=[0.25, 0.25, 0.25, 0.25], # equal weight across 4 rewards
|
|
gradient_checkpointing=True,
|
|
bf16=True,
|
|
logging_steps=10,
|
|
logging_first_step=True,
|
|
logging_strategy="steps",
|
|
disable_tqdm=True,
|
|
save_strategy="steps",
|
|
save_steps=200,
|
|
save_total_limit=2,
|
|
push_to_hub=False,
|
|
log_completions=False,
|
|
report_to="none",
|
|
seed=42,
|
|
)
